About Ulrike

Ulrike Kasper is an art historian, artist and author living in Paris. Paris, itself, has become one of her passions. During her lectures and tours, she has developed paths through the history, the architecture, and the arts of Paris, weaving links between its past and present. For thirty years, she has been teaching art and architecture, including modern and contemporary art, in various universities, including the Sorbonne, Skidmore College in Paris, and the Institute of European Studies.

As an art historian with a deep interest in music, Ulrike has published several books on contemporary art, art and music, and various articles. When she is not walking through Paris, she is painting or dancing tango.
